目录: 1.案例:阻止超链接默认跳转行为 2.案例:相册 3.案例:列表隔行变色 4.案例:列表鼠标进入高亮显示(鼠标进入和鼠标移出事件) 5.显示和隐藏二维码 6.通过name属性获取元素(表单标签才有那么属性) 7.根据类样式的名字获取元素 ...
一 三种获取页面元素的方式: getElementById:通过id来获取 getElementByTagName:通过标签名来获取 getElementByClassName:通过类名来获取 注意:getElementsByClassName有很强的兼容性问题,一般不用 二 事件: 事件的三要素:事件源 事件名称 事件的处理程序 里面执行的代码或代码段 如何注册一个点击事件 注册事件的两种方式小 ...
2016-08-05 23:12 0 5992 推荐指数:
目录: 1.案例:阻止超链接默认跳转行为 2.案例:相册 3.案例:列表隔行变色 4.案例:列表鼠标进入高亮显示(鼠标进入和鼠标移出事件) 5.显示和隐藏二维码 6.通过name属性获取元素(表单标签才有那么属性) 7.根据类样式的名字获取元素 ...
1. 在html标签中直接绑定; 2. 在js中获取到相应的dom元素后绑定; 3. 在js中使用addEventListener()实现绑定; 具体代码示例如下: ...
动态创建元素的三种方式: 第一种: Document.write(); 使用documen.write()创建元素时,会发生一个问题:默认情况之下,页面由上而下地加载,形成一个文档流,当执行完毕时,文档流就会关闭,从而将之前生成的元素冲刷掉,所以不推荐使用这种方法。 第二种 ...
js获取dom的方法 1.通过ID获取 getElementById() <body> <div id="box"></div> </body> <script> const box ...
案例如下: 先来看一下直接效果:最大的区 innerHTML 获取内容的时候,会把标签也获取到 innerText 获取内容的时候,会把标签过滤掉 ...
1.innerHTML属性和innerText属性 都是对元素的一个操作,简单讲,innerHTML可以在某种特定环境下重构某个元素节点的DOM结构,innerText只能修改文本值 在JavaScript高级程序设计(第三版)是这样描述的: 在只读模式下 ...
document.write() document.write('新设置的内容<p>标签也可以生成</p>'); innerHTML var box = document.getElementById('box'); box.innerHTML = '新内容< ...